Miley out to kill Hannah — Dolly
AS Miley Cyrus recovers in hospital from “an extremely allergic reaction” to an antibiotic that forced her to cancel her US tour, her godmother, Dolly Parton, spoke of concern for the 21year-old pop star.
Parton said she started to worry when Cyrus told her she needed “to murder Hannah Montana”, the squeaky-clean character she portrayed in a Disney Channel series.
“One day she’d had enough and told me: ‘I need to murder Hannah Montana in order for people to accept who I really am’,” Parton told The Sun.
Cyrus has become notorious for her increasingly risque performances on stage. Her sexually provocative twerking provoked outrage.
“I’m hoping that she holds it in on the road and doesn’t do so many things that are that bizarre,” said Parton. “I don’t think the crowd would be so forgiving again if she did anything else that was really offensive. I don’t want it to overshadow her talent.”
Parton, a close friend of Cyrus’s father, Billy Ray Cyrus, said that she is “very worried” about his daughter’s nonchalant attitude towards drugs. The Wrecking Ball singer has admitted to trying cocaine and enjoying dagga.
“I think weed is the best drug on earth. One time I smoked a joint with peyote in it, and I saw a wolf howling at the moon,” Cyrus told Rolling Stone last year, adding: “I really don’t like coke. It’s so gross and so dark.”
Cyrus this week hit out from her hospital bed against suggestions that her illness had darker undertones. She tweeted that her critics should “shut up” and “let me heal”.
